On Monday 17 March St Patrick’s Day is celebrated in Ireland and worldwide. In Montevideo, as in previous years, The Shannon Irish Pub invites us to celebrate with them at Bme. Mitre 1318. For reservations call 916-9585
We have also received an invitation from Patricio R. Sullivan, President of the FEDERACION DE SOCIEDADES ARGENTINO IRLANDESAS, who through Mr. Dickie McAllister, have offered their support to our newborn community.
The various celebrations on 17 March in Buenos Aires will count with the visit of Mr. Dermot Ahern, T.D. Irish Minister of Foreign Affaires and Irish Ambassador to the Southern Cone Mrs. Philomena Murnaghan.
Almost a year later after this project began we are glad to count with around one hundred registered members who have demonstrated their interest in the community. Though slow, this registration is constant and sustained. The specific interests differ but are mainly concentrated in the following topics:
- Search of Irish ancestors and relatives
- Interest in Irish language
- Irish traditions and culture
- Intellectual and commercial exchange
The community is slowly shaping up to what it will look like. We have received several offers to support and continue developing this project which we will happily implement in due course.
We want to highlight that we have received the support from the Embassy of Ireland in Buenos Aires in the name of Ambassador Mrs. Philomena Murnaghan who has shown great interest in the Irish community in Uruguay. The Federación de Sociedades Argentino Irlandesas has also offered their support and experience which they have acquired by coordinating the activities of more than 40 Argentine-Irish Societies. In March 2008 a delegation of the Old Christians from Montevideo will visit Ireland. As mentioned by Guillermo Del Cerro (OCC) and Hugh Ryan (Skerries, Ireland) several activities will take place as well as football and rugby matches between them and local teams. It is a great opportunity to tighten the bonds between both countries.
